During the 2022-2023 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at FTCC paid an average of $268 per credit hour if they came to the school from out-of-state. In-state students paid a discounted rate of $76 per credit hour. Information about average full-time undergradu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.
| In State | Out of State | |
|---|---|---|
| Tuition | $2,432 | $8,576 |
| Fees | $196 | $196 |
| Books and Supplies | $1,652 | $1,652 |

The computer & information sciences program at FTCC awarded 74 associate's degrees in 2021-2022. About 76% of these degrees went to men with the other 24% going to women.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Fayetteville Technical Community College with a associate's in computer & information sciences.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 2 |
| Black or African American | 31 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 6 |
| White | 27 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
| Other Races | 8 |
